You Want Something?

Then Go Get It!

In order to get something you’ve never had, you have to do something you’ve never done!  If there is something you want in life just wishing it was so isn’t enough.  You have to take action and do the work to attain it no matter how daunting things may seem at times.  Keep the faith, it’s usually the moment you decide to give up is right before the moment your dreams are to become a reality.

I know at times getting knocked down can be really discouraging but those are the times when you are truly being tested.  It is the time when your determination must be greater than your doubt, your passion too strong to allow for any other outcome.  Anything worth having, anything placed in your soul and your heart is worth fighting for even in the face of challenge.

Encouragement or discouragement can be the breaking point if you let it especially when time and patience are a requirement for your dream.

Don’t ever let anyone tell you what is not possible for you!  If you have a goal, a dream and you feel that when you share it with others they try to derail your plans and say it’s impossible then the solution is simple, only share your dreams with those who love and support your vision.  You need people around who motivate you not to give up, who remind you that you can do it, who dive into your vision with you and experience the glory of imagination and dream.

It doesn’t matter if you or anyone else may think on some level of “reality” that what you want is a pipe dream because I can assure you nothing is impossible for you!  The only time it becomes impossible is when you start to believe the naysayers, when you let the seeds of doubt creep in.  As long as you have passion to chase it with everything in you then impossible turns into I’m possible.

The world has become abundant with “instant gratification” in so many ways which has both good and bad sides to it.  I guess the upside is that you get something you want right away and you don’t have to wait but then how much do you value it, does it become a prized possession?  Likely not because prized possessions are usually something that you put blood, sweat and tears into which is why you cherish them.

So then the downside would be that you don’t appreciate what you’ve attained because it was too easy to get.  When you really have to work hard and wait for a dream to manifest you have no choice but to build your patience, for those of you that struggle with patience, like me, that is a task in itself.  When you do start to see things come to fruition it builds so much more; self-worth, self-esteem, pride, confidence, belief in yourself, inner strength and the list goes on.

When you’ve reached a goal or dream you tend to want to hold onto it more and not let it go, not gripping too tightly but in a treasured kind of way.  It becomes your personal badge of honor on your soul, not for others to be impressed by you but for you to feel proud of the commitment you nurtured into your reality.

If you feel there is something more you desire and you want more passion and purpose in your life start with where your heart goes when you let your mind wander.  The solutions lie within the stillness of your mind, in the quiet moments you hear the answers to your most pertinent questions.  You were not born to live a mediocre life, you are destined to live your best life!

Find your passion and it will lead you to your purpose!

Follow Your Vision

What You See Is What You Get!

What you think about most is what you are embracing and implanting into your subconscious and conscious mind whether you realize it or not. The key to cultivating positive experiences in your life is to begin cultivating them with your thoughts.

Your self-talk is important, you must first believe in yourself, you must have faith that the Universe has a plan for you and then allow that plan to manifest knowing it is for the betterment of your higher self.

follow your dreams

Having a clear vision of what you expect to see manifest in your life is the ace in your pocket. My vision has always been clear to me, sure there are some alterations along the way that change the course at times but I never get so far off that I lose sight of my vision. There are times when my vision changes in perspective, sometimes life’s joys and/or upsets change the view but I believe that these changes are meant to be, they are meant to shape you so you fit into the Universe’s plan for you.

What you See is What You Get:  I think it is important to really allow this thought to sink in.

You can tell yourself what you want to see but if you really don’t believe it yourself then you can forget about seeing it manifest in your life. It’s not just about saying the words, it’s about taking the actions making what you see start to take a form. You must know that feeling when you begin taking action of any task, you start to see it take shape and before you know it you’re half way to completion. That feeling is inspiration, followed by momentum to see it through and what follows are the rewards of success for your accomplishment. This is the format that exists in everything, it is purely passion, passion to move in desired direction, passion to power through the rough patches, passion to pursue that which you know you can attain and passion to succeed. You must know you that you can do anything you put your heart and mind into.

Sometimes getting to the other side of success can feel overwhelming, sometimes enough to make you question your abilities and/or goals:

  • What do I do now?
  • How do I maintain?
  • Have I reached my potential?

Here’s what you do:

  • Enjoy it
  • Relax a little
  • Marinate the next ideas of change you desire

There’s always another mountain to climb, there’s always another challenge ahead and there is never a dull moment because inspiration is always available. Don’t paint yourself into a corner and say there’s no way out, there is always a way out, you will find your best answers within your imagination.

Imagination is not just for kids, the only reason kids access is more is because they aren’t jaded, they are uninhibited and unwilling to accept that there is something they can’t do or try.

I think a lot of us limit our vision because life itself seen through the eyes of negativity is clouded but when you change that view and realize that there are no limits I think you would be amazed at what you can accomplish!

I Imagine!

Manifesting Your Future

You have to start somewhere, and your imagination is full of all the ideas you really want but may believe aren’t available to you, but they are!

Don’t cut your ideas off simply because you feel they aren’t options, honestly if they are imagined ideas then they aren’t currently happening, right? So what’s the worst that can happen if you entertain those ideas, they don’t occur? So then you’re still right where you are, but…….what if they do happen? How great would that be? There is not a downside as far as I see and you just might get what you want.

So what would you imagine? I know when I imagine things I want to see manifest in my life they are never limited and always seem like a magical gift. I think that you need to have big ideas and big dreams because when you are in your imagination you are allowing your highest self the chance to have a voice. With all that life has going on for each of you through difficulty or success that often quells the voice of your highest self, especially during the more challenging times. I believe that happens not because you aren’t honoring or loving yourself but because some experiences take more of you with them. All experiences change you, either for the better or the worse, they may place you in a holding pattern until you decide which of those paths to take.

If you were back in the days of childhood what would your inner voice say then? What would you imagine? As kids we have all sorts of dreams, imaginations that have no limits and just because you’ve aged doesn’t mean that the opportunities are lost. Why not allow that inner child of yours to have a little input in your adult mind, just for a few moments. Try it!

I Imagine! What’s there in your thoughts of imagination? I can tell you there are many things I’ve imagined to occur that I’ve written down and forgotten. I’ve been doing a lot of cleaning out as of late and come across a few of them, only to realize that most of them (if not all) have been fulfilled. I’ve found that while it’s great to have a focus, a determination of all that you want to see manifest in your life and keep it in your thoughts consistently. It’s also important to put it out into the Universe like a balloon sailing in the sky, it’s important to let it go and gain its own momentum and life force. It’s not that I’ve forgotten these parts of my imagination but I put it out there, let it go and lived my life going in the direction of that life force and the Universe responded, not because I was especially deserving but because I did the work, I believed and I let it go. Everything will happen as it’s supposed to and when it’s supposed to but you need to trust in it and have faith.

Try it out, allow your imagination the opportunity to have a voice, write down the things you want to see happen in your life, the most important thing to be aware of is that anything of negative intention will NEVER manifest the way you want. Anything in your imagination comes from a place of light and positivity, anything negative comes from the ego, not your imagination.

If you want to see something positive manifest from your imagination, it needs to come from a place of good intention, intention that brings only positive outward effects to all those around you. Believe in it, let it go and trust that it will gain its own life force and that the Universe will fulfill it in your life!

Sometimes You Have to Travel a Long Road

To Go a Short Distance!

It doesn’t matter what others do, it matters what you do!

Every occurrence, circumstance or event happens for a reason and usually that reason is connected to our own higher learning. I’ve thought in the past that when someone treated me in a way that was either manipulative, disrespectful or both that they deserved eternal condemnation but that’s not for me to decide. The Universe will handle it appropriately and in the right time, I need to trust in that, step back and draw some better boundaries to ensure it doesn’t happen again. We teach others how to treat us and honestly I’ve been a little too lax in my teachings in the past. I’ve often thought that the way I treated someone would be teaching enough as to how I also wanted to be treated but their intention in life may not be in alignment with mine. Learning how to decipher their intention and find only those that are in alignment with my intention is the lesson I am still fine-tuning.

I’ve always been someone that is super motivated to get to the next level so I can find out what the level after that is and so forth. I’ve come across people who live in a negative energy but have learned how to display passion that they also want to get to the next level but the truth of it is that if they wanted to get to the next level they would be doing something, anything, to be trying to get there and the lack that seems to be stalling them in place is really their own will or desire. The issue for them is that they have become content, familiar and/or addicted to their story because it serves as a great example/reason for the obstacles that prevent them from moving forward. The problem that will continue to plague them is that they are living in a negative mindset or point of view and that prevents the Universe from bringing the positive light in so the life that they secretly hope for but believe they don’t deserve can manifest.

live your truth

Imagine if you were meant for great things, which I believe we all are, we aren’t here to suffer, we are here to build and grow our souls so they can flourish but that can’t happen if a wall of negativity is blocking it from getting through. The biggest hurdle to letting all the good things get in is tearing down that wall and embracing that which makes you feel vulnerable or scared. Every time a monumental moment occurs hesitation is always there and rightly so, all monumental moments are the cusp of some impending change that will likely alter you in every area of life, which is why they are so scary and why we hesitate. Taking a leap of faith into unknown and unfamiliar territory is unnerving to say the least but every time I’ve ever done it I’ve never been disappointed, not even once! Even if it hasn’t led me to where I thought I was going, it has led me to something better.

It may seem easier, less scary, to keep yourself safely behind the protective armor of a negative mindset because at least you’re familiar with it, no one can hurt you there because you are already in defensive/protective mode but no good can get in either. So what you block out that hurts also prevents that which is good from getting through, I ask you, what’s more hurtful?

Even though the bad stuff feels rough, hurts and sometimes feels too overwhelming to overcome, it still comes with its gifts. That which does not kill me, only makes me stronger!

The more of the tough experiences you go through the stronger you get, the more resilient you get, the more capable you are of reaching for what you want and succeeding and when you combine that with embracing all things positive you more than double the power you’ve already gained from your experiences.

Sometimes you have to travel a long road to go a short distance. Imagine what you can do when you realize how powerful you already are!
